Improved finite difference method with a compact correction term for solving Poisson’s equations

An improved finite difference method with a compact correction term is proposed to solve the Poisson’s equations. The compact correction term is developed by coupled high-order compact and low-order classical finite difference formulations. The numerical solutions obtained by the classical finite difference method are considered as fundamental solutions with lower accuracy, whereas a compact correction term is added into the source term of classical discrete formulation to improve the accuracy of numerical solutions. The proposed method can be extended from two-dimensional to multidimensional cases straightforwardly. Numerical experiments are carried out to verify the accuracy and efficiency of this method.
